In this important role, the Hardware Engineer Sr Stf will:

- Prepare functional requirements and specifications for hardware acquisitions

- Analyze hardware specifications and system/subsystem requirements to conceive and document a practical design for hardware components to include servers, network devices, transmission media, storage devices, user interface devices, and special processors

- Ensure that problems with operational hardware have been properly identified and solutions will satisfy the user’s requirements

- Assist with preparing installation guides, field test procedures, and troubleshooting guides

- Conduct site surveys; assesses and documents current site network configuration and site unique requirements

- Develop hardware installation schedules based upon set-up, integration, and test timelines

- Train site personnel in proper use of hardware

- Recommend specifications for hardware acquisitions

- Prepare engineering plans and site installation Technical Design Packages

- Prepare drawings documenting as-built configurations at each site

- Prepare site installation and test reports

- Configure computers, communications devices and peripheral equipment

- Prepare installation guides, field test procedures, and troubleshooting guides

- Organize and directs hardware installations across multiple sites

- Design and verify test harnesses/simulated interfaces for all test and integration phases

- Analyze and recommend hardware specifications for project-unique or modified commercial hardware

- Assist with building simulations of proposed systems and provides hardware throughput analyses to system engineers

- Prepare Mean-Time-Between-Failure and Mean-Time-To-Repair analyses

- Analyze operational data to identify choke points, failure modes, and other data for design or maintainability improvements

Basic Qualifications:

- TS/SCI with polygraph required.

- Twenty (20) years experience as a HE analyzing complex hardware systems for SIGINT solutions is required

- Bachelor’s degree in Communications Engineering, Computer Engineering, Computer Science, Electrical Engineering, Information Systems, Mathematics, or related discipline from an accredited college or university is required.

- Five (5) years of additional hardware engineering experience may be substituted for a bachelor’s degree
